Benke Rydman creates an Avicii-inspired show

The director and choreographer Fredrik "Benke" Rydman is putting on a show based on Avicii's music. In "Lonely together", the audience gets to stand on stage together with actors, dancers, and live musicians.

Fredrik Rydman worked with Tim "Avicii" Bergling to create his world tour before the artist and composer decided not to tour anymore.

I got very much into the music and I think that has been lying and growing inside me. There was something in the music – in the melodies and lyrics – that was a bigger story. That's where I found the inspiration, says Fredrik "Benke" Rydman.

Experimenting

He has made modern versions of, among other things, "Swan Lake", "The Nutcracker" and "Matilda the musical". Now he wants to experiment with the boundaries between dance, music, and theater, to create a total work of art. The audience is on stage with the musicians and dancers, in a story that revolves around a couple's deepest secrets.

He and Avicii used to talk about concerts as a place where you can be free and feel community, tells Fredrik Rydman. That's the feeling he wants to achieve.

It's some kind of gathering place where everyone comes to, in that room we find the meeting. Speaking of feeling freedom and a greater sense of community in a not so obvious way but in a poetic way, that's my goal. So you go out and feel "wow, there's still a little hope and light in this time".

Poetic Images

The music is Avicii's, Fredrik Rydman thinks that the melodies with elements of both Swedish folk tradition and country have a strong emotional power. But here the music is rearranged and shaped through dance, text, and music, in grand poetic images.

I hope you'll come along on the journey and get swept away.

Fredrik "Benke" Rydman is a choreographer, dancer, and director who got his breakthrough in the dance group Bounce.

Avicii – whose real name was Tim Bergling (1989–2018), was a Swedish DJ, producer, and songwriter who broke through with the Grammy-nominated single "Levels" in 2011.

In "Lonely together" you'll see Peter Gardiner, Maja Rung, Fredrik and Alexander Lycke, Lisette T Pagler, and Sofia Papadimitriou Ledarp, together with about ten dancers and live musicians.

The performance premieres on August 29 at Kulturhuset Stadsteatern in Stockholm.
